fluorescent to daylight?
my plant is about 2 weeks into flowering and its hard for me to keep a steady 12/12 light cycle since im always out. Is it ok for me to transfer my plant from my grow room which was being lighted by a cfl, to outside so it gets a steady 12/12 light cycle?

fluorescent to daylight?
I'd keep them partly protected from the sun for a day or two to let them adjust to the stronger light. Or put them out when you expect several cloudy days. I've seen plants (veggies & flowers) get "sunburned" after being raised inside. It's starting to snow....again.
